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- 1 Place the ingredients in the bread machine pan in the order listed or as recommended by your machine's manufacturer. 2 You can adjust the garlic and onion to your preference. 3 Don't let the salt touch the yeast. 4 At this point you can either select White Bread and press Start to complete in the bread machine, or use the dough setting and finish in the oven. 5 I prefer the oven method as it seems to result in a higher loaf with better texture. 6 Directions for oven method: Select dough cycle and press start. 7 When complete, turn the dough out onto a floured surface and punch down. 8 Flatten out into a rectangle, patting to get out bubbles. 9 Roll tightly into a log, turn seam side down, and tuck the ends under. 10 Place into a loaf pan that has been lightly greased with olive oil, loosely cover with plastic wrap sprayed with nonstick spray, and let rise in a warm place for 45 minutes or until doubled. 11 Bake in a preheated 350 degree oven for 30 minutes or until done (if the bottom of the loaf sounds hollow when tapped, it's done). 12 Immediately remove from loaf pan and cool on a wire rack at least 10-15 minutes before slicing.
